Start with resolution and pixel density because they matter more than marketing numbers. A 1080p frame looks great at 8 to 10 inches, but once you push to 15 inches or more, higher pixel counts keep images crisp and textures believable. Also think about viewing distance: a larger frame viewed from a few feet needs more pixels per inch to avoid a soft, blocky look.
Panel type changes how pictures feel in the room, not just how many pixels you get. IPS LCD panels deliver wide viewing angles and reliable color, while OLED brings deep blacks and punchy contrast that make portraits pop. E ink gives a paper-like look with ultra-low power use for static galleries, and emerging microLED tech promises the best of both with high brightness and efficiency when it becomes available at consumer price points.
Color accuracy and brightness are the next vote winners for image quality. Look for frames that support wide color gamuts and have decent factory calibration or the option to tweak settings; otherwise skin tones and subtle hues can look off. Brightness plus anti-reflective coatings matters if the frame sits near windows or under lights, because a vivid panel that glare-washes will still disappoint.
Contrast and dynamic range decide how photos handle highlights and shadows. Panels that can show deep blacks alongside bright highlights preserve more detail in tricky scenes, especially backlit portraits or high-contrast landscapes. Some frames advertise HDR support, but implementation varies; true benefit comes from a display that preserves detail without crushing mids or blowing out bright spots.
Motion handling and image processing are easy to overlook until you notice blur or artifacts during slideshows. Faster refresh and better internal scaling keep pan and zoom effects smooth, and smarter upscaling reduces edge halos around compressed photos. Equally important is how the frame handles file formats and compression; support for higher-bitrate JPEGs or PNGs keeps detail intact and avoids banding on gradients.
Connectivity and software shape daily experience once image quality is settled. Cloud syncing, local Wi-Fi, USB, and SD card options all have tradeoffs: cloud makes updating convenient, local storage gives privacy and zero-lag access, and USB remains the simplest for one-off transfers. Check app quality and account rules because poorly designed software can downscale or recompress uploads, undermining an otherwise great screen.
Design and power matter in practical use. Slim bezels and neutral finishes help the photo, not the frame, stand out, while wall-mounting hardware and stable stands dictate placement flexibility. Decide whether you want a plugged-in setup for constant display or a battery option for portability; batteries mean fewer wires but more compromises in brightness and continuous uptime.
